About azetidin-1-yl-[4-[(4-fluoro-2-methyl-1H-indol-5-yl)oxy]-6-[4-[(4-methylpiperazin-1-yl)methyl]-3-(trifluoromethyl)anilino]pyrimidin-5-yl]methanone
azetidin-1-yl-[4-[(4-fluoro-2-methyl-1H-indol-5-yl)oxy]-6-[4-[(4-methylpiperazin-1-yl)methyl]-3-(trifluoromethyl)anilino]pyrimidin-5-yl]methanone (PubChem CID 122520591) has the molecular formula C30H31F4N7O2
and a molecular weight of 597.62 g/mol. Its IUPAC name is azetidin-1-yl-[4-[(4-fluoro-2-methyl-1H-indol-5-yl)oxy]-6-[4-[(4-methylpiperazin-1-yl)methyl]-3-(trifluoromethyl)anilino]pyrimidin-5-yl]methanone.
